Output 699da477cc63e5d24a0559e9bd9f9fd88cefc13a2abdc05c823fd455f17eba4f:7

value
1262972568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e644a9f9ec08cb23d3100a502d8366ae6a439b61 OP_EQUAL
address
3NgZbXAvXcnJM3sGqKrJxGEwci42W8aWjJ
transaction
699da477cc63e5d24a0559e9bd9f9fd88cefc13a2abdc05c823fd455f17eba4f
spent
true